Possible Causes of Smoke Damage

Smoke damage in homes and businesses often occurs due to residential fires, whether accidental or electrical in nature. When a fire occurs, the combustion releases smoke that can deeply penetrate walls, furniture, and structural elements, leaving behind stubborn residues that are difficult to clean.

Other causes include appliance malfunctions, such as faulty heaters or stoves, and Wildfires that can lead to widespread smoke infiltration. Even a small, overlooked fire source can cause significant smoke residues, compromising indoor air quality and necessitating professional cleanup. It’s crucial to address smoke damage promptly to prevent further deterioration and health risks.

How We Can Fix Smoke Damage

Our team begins with a thorough assessment to determine the extent of smoke and soot infiltration. We utilize advanced cleaning techniques designed specifically for smoke residues to prevent staining and odors from setting in. Our specialists then proceed with deep cleaning of affected surfaces, including walls, ceilings, furniture, and HVAC systems, to remove all traces of smoke and soot.

We also employ specialized deodorization methods, such as ozone treatments and thermal fogging, to eliminate persistent smoke odors that can linger long after the visible damage has been addressed. Our process involves sealing porous materials when necessary to prevent smoke odors from permeating further into the structure.

Frequently Asked Questions

How long does smoke damage cleanup take?

The duration depends on the severity of the fire and the extent of smoke infiltration. Typically, for minor cases, cleanup can be completed within a few days, while more extensive damage may take longer. Our team works efficiently to restore your property as quickly as possible.

Will my belongings be cleaned or replaced?

We evaluate each item on a case-by-case basis. Many personal belongings and furniture can be cleaned and deodorized effectively. If certain items are severely damaged or contaminated, we can advise on the best options for replacement or specialist restoration services.

Is smoke odor completely removable?

In most cases, our advanced deodorization techniques can eliminate smoke odors entirely. However, in some situations involving deeply porous materials, complete removal may require additional treatments. Our experts will assess your specific case and recommend the most effective solutions.

Can I remain in my home during the cleanup?

Depending on the extent of smoke residues and the cleaning methods used, some clients may choose to stay while the restoration is underway. In cases requiring extensive deodorization or controlled environments, temporary relocation might be recommended for safety and comfort. Our team will provide guidance tailored to your situation.

How can I prevent future smoke damage?

Regular maintenance of appliances, installation of smoke detectors, and safe practices in the kitchen and heating systems can significantly reduce the risk of fire and smoke damage. Our specialists can also offer tips for fire prevention and safety to help keep your property secure.
